Troubleshooting Yoast SEO in WordPress: A Practical Guide

Yoast SEO is arguably the most popular Search Engine Optimization (SEO) plugin for WordPress, empowering millions of website owners to optimize their content for search engines like Google. However, despite its robust features and widespread use, users frequently encounter issues where Yoast SEO appears to stop working correctly. This can manifest in various ways, from the readability analysis failing to load, to the sitemap returning a 404 error, or even complete incompatibility with the WordPress editor. This guide provides a detailed, step-by-step approach to diagnosing and resolving common Yoast SEO problems in WordPress, ensuring your website remains optimized for search visibility.

Understanding the Core Functionality of Yoast SEO

Before diving into troubleshooting, it’s crucial to understand what Yoast SEO does. At its core, Yoast SEO aims to improve a website’s ranking in search engine results pages (SERPs). It achieves this through several key features:

  • Content Analysis: Yoast analyzes the content of your posts and pages, providing feedback on keyword usage, readability, link density, and other factors that influence SEO.
  • Meta Data Optimization: The plugin allows you to customize meta titles and descriptions, which are crucial for attracting clicks from search results.
  • XML Sitemap Generation: Yoast automatically generates an XML sitemap, which helps search engines crawl and index your website more efficiently.
  • Schema Markup: It adds structured data markup to your pages, providing search engines with more context about your content.
  • Readability Analysis: Yoast assesses the readability of your content, suggesting improvements to sentence structure and paragraph length.

When any of these features malfunction, it signals a problem that needs addressing. The issues can stem from plugin conflicts, incorrect settings, WordPress updates, or even server-side configurations.

Diagnosing the Problem: Common Symptoms and Initial Checks

The first step in resolving a Yoast SEO issue is accurately identifying the symptom. Here are some common problems users report:

  • Yoast SEO Meta Box Missing: The Yoast SEO meta box disappears from the post editor.
  • Readability Analysis Not Working: The readability analysis section doesn’t load or displays an error message.
  • SEO Analysis Not Working: Similar to readability, the SEO analysis section fails to function.
  • Sitemap 404 Error: Accessing your sitemap (usually https://yourdomain.com/sitemap_index.xml) results in a 404 Not Found error.
  • Editor Conflicts: The Yoast SEO plugin causes issues with the WordPress editor, such as crashes or layout problems.

Once you’ve identified the symptom, perform these initial checks:

  1. Plugin Activation: Ensure the Yoast SEO plugin is actually activated in your WordPress dashboard (Plugins > Installed Plugins).
  2. Plugin Updates: Verify that you are running the latest version of Yoast SEO. Outdated plugins are often the source of compatibility issues.
  3. WordPress Version: Confirm that your WordPress installation is up-to-date. Compatibility issues can arise between plugins and older WordPress versions.
  4. Cache Clearing: Clear your browser cache and any caching plugins you may be using (like WP Rocket, W3 Total Cache, or LiteSpeed Cache). Cached data can sometimes interfere with plugin functionality.

Step-by-Step Troubleshooting: Addressing Common Issues

If the initial checks don’t resolve the problem, proceed with these more detailed troubleshooting steps.

1. Enabling Yoast Features

Yoast SEO has several features that can be individually enabled or disabled. Ensure that the core features are activated:

  1. Navigate to SEO > General > Features.
  2. Confirm that both “SEO analysis” and “Readability analysis” are enabled. If either is disabled, enable it and save your changes.

2. Verifying the Yoast SEO Meta Box Configuration

The Yoast SEO meta box needs to be configured to display in the post editor.

  1. Go to SEO > Search Appearance > Content Types.
  2. Ensure that the “Yoast SEO meta box” option is set to “Show” for the content types you want to optimize (Posts, Pages, etc.).

3. User Role Permissions and SEO Analysis

In some cases, the SEO analysis feature might be disabled for specific user roles.

  1. Go to Users > All Users.
  2. Edit the user profile experiencing the issue.
  3. Scroll down to the “Yoast SEO settings” section and ensure that “Disable SEO analysis” is not checked.
  4. Update the user profile.

4. Resolving Sitemap 404 Errors

A 404 error for your sitemap indicates that the sitemap file is either missing or inaccessible. Here’s how to fix it:

  1. Resave Permalinks: Go to Settings > Permalinks and simply click “Save Changes” (even if you don’t make any changes). This often refreshes the rewrite rules and resolves the issue.
  2. Check .htaccess File: Incorrect rules in your .htaccess file can prevent WordPress from displaying the sitemap. Improper manual edits, faulty plugin updates, or theme changes can cause this. Caution: Editing the .htaccess file requires technical expertise. Incorrect modifications can break your website.
  3. Re-generate Sitemap: Go to SEO > Tools > Features and click the "Re-save permalinks" button. Then navigate to SEO > XML Sitemaps and click the "Re-generate sitemap" button.

5. Addressing Plugin and Theme Conflicts

Plugin and theme conflicts are a common cause of Yoast SEO issues.

  1. Deactivate Other Plugins: Temporarily deactivate all other plugins except Yoast SEO. If the problem resolves, reactivate the plugins one by one, testing after each activation, to identify the conflicting plugin.
  2. Switch to a Default Theme: Temporarily switch to a default WordPress theme (like Twenty Twenty-Three). If the problem resolves, the issue lies within your theme.

Comparing Common Troubleshooting Steps

Here's a table summarizing the troubleshooting steps and their potential impact:

Issue Troubleshooting Step Potential Impact
Meta Box Missing Verify Content Type Settings Restores the Yoast SEO meta box in the editor.
Readability/SEO Not Working Enable Features Activates the analysis features within Yoast SEO.
Sitemap 404 Error Resave Permalinks Refreshes rewrite rules, making the sitemap accessible.
General Malfunction Deactivate Other Plugins Identifies conflicting plugins.
General Malfunction Switch to Default Theme Identifies theme-related conflicts.

Known Conflicts and Compatibility Issues

The WordPress community frequently reports conflicts between Yoast SEO and other plugins or themes. Some commonly reported issues include:

  • Divi Builder: Compatibility issues can cause editor layout problems.
  • Elementor: Similar to Divi, Elementor can sometimes conflict with Yoast SEO.
  • Oxygen Builder: Yoast SEO has been known to break the Oxygen Builder editor.
  • Caching Plugins: Aggressive caching can sometimes interfere with Yoast SEO’s functionality.

Refer to the WordPress support forums (https://wordpress.org/support/) for the latest information on known conflicts and workarounds.

Frequently Asked Questions

  • Why is my Yoast SEO sitemap so large? A large sitemap is generally not a problem, but it can be split into multiple sitemaps if it exceeds the file size limit. Yoast SEO handles this automatically.
  • Can Yoast SEO slow down my website? Yoast SEO can add some overhead, but it’s generally minimal. Optimizing your website’s caching and using a lightweight theme can mitigate any performance impact.
  • Is Yoast SEO necessary for SEO? While not strictly necessary, Yoast SEO provides a comprehensive set of tools that significantly simplify the SEO process.

The Bottom Line

Yoast SEO is a powerful plugin that can greatly enhance your website’s search engine optimization. However, like any complex software, it can occasionally encounter issues. By systematically following the troubleshooting steps outlined in this guide, you can effectively diagnose and resolve most common problems, ensuring that your website remains visible and competitive in the ever-evolving world of search. Remember to always back up your website before making any significant changes, and consult the official Yoast SEO documentation and support forums for further assistance.

Sources

  1. Yoast Readability & SEO Analysis Not Working
  2. Troubleshooting Yoast SEO Editor Issues After a WordPress Update
  3. How to Fix Yoast SEO Sitemap 404 Error in WordPress

Related Posts